The High Court harshly slammed the State’s conduct on the matter of the demolition of terrorists’ homes.
During a hearing on appeals made by the families of terrorists whose homes are slated to be demolished, the presiding judge spoke out against the State.
“First the State says that the demolition is urgent and put pressure on the entire system, then once a ruling is made, they begin to delay? There were cases that were approved, but then the government delayed for months regarding implementation. And then they said that the court delayed matters," the judge said.
